Dragon’s Dogma 2 Hunt for the Jadeite Orb walkthrough

The Hunt for the Jadeite Orb quest begins once you make your way to the Checkpoint Rest Town. The easiest way to do this is to take the ox cart at the western gate of Vermund. Once here, a beastren named Offulve will approach you saying they lost a Jadeite Orb and asking you to retrieve it for them.

Head a bit to the north, and you’ll be approached by a second NPC – Everard. He’s the one who originally gave Offulve the Orb, and is looking for it himself. You have a choice, you can either give the Orb to Offulve and let him sell it to help make a new life for himself, or return it to Everard.

Where to find the Jadeite Orb

Offulve will tell you to speak to a bandit to help with its whereabouts. You can head to Vernworth gaol to speak to a prisoner who will tell you about Ibrahim’s Scrap Store. This store is located in the Checkpoint Rest Town, so don’t bother heading to Vernworth.

Instead, turn right at the end of the high street, around the corner from where Everard is hanging around to a small street behind the vocation guild to find a small shop with a merchant NPC waiting. Talk to shopkeeper Ibrahim to find you can buy the titular Jadeite Orb from him for 7,500G.  At this point you can bring it back to your person of choice, but…

You may also notice that Ibrahim can create forgeries. For another 2,000G you can make yourself a forgery of the Jadeite Orb to give to one of Everard and Offluve to trick them. This will take a few days, so give Ibrahim the Orb and head off and do another quest, like the nearby Prey for the Pack side quest.

Should you give the Jadeite Orb to Offulve or Everard?

Once you’ve got your forgery, it’s time to hand over the Orbs, but who should you give the real one to? We think that the best possible outcome is to give the Jadeite Orb to Everard. 

If you give the real Jadeite Orb to Offulve, you don’t gain any additional rewards. Furthermore, Everard will require a test to check if it’s the real Orb, taking it to Ibrahim. You can bribe Ibrahim to tell Everard that it’s real, but this will cost you another 6,000G.

If you give Offluve the fake Jadeite Orb, he will reward you with 3,000G and an Elite Camping Kit, thinking that the Orb is real. You can then give the real Orb to Everard, pass the test without having to bribe Ibrahim and be rewarded with 12,000G (meaning a 5,500G profit) and a Ring of Skullduggery which deals increased damage when attacking from behind.

There is no morality system in Dragon’s Dogma 2, and Offluve doesn’t appear again in the game, so there’s no downside in giving him the forgery. The only thing that happens is your Pawns may briefly discuss that they feel bad for deceiving Offluve, but who cares what they think, eh?

Where is the Jadeite Orb in Dragon’s Dogma 2?

The Jadeite Orb can be bought from Ibrahim’s Scrap Shop in the Checkpoint Border Town.
